WebCanonical correspondence analysis. In multivariate analysis, canonical correspondence analysis ( CCA) is an ordination technique that determines axes from the response data as a linear combination of measured predictors. CCA is commonly used in ecology in order to extract gradients that drive the composition of ecological communities. WebMay 24, 2024 · Constrained correspondence analysis is indeed a constrained method: CCA does not try to display all variation in the data, but only the part that can be explained by the used constraints. Consequently, the results are strongly dependent on the set of constraints and their transformations or interactions among the constraints. WebSep 24, 2024 · Correspondence analysis ( CA) is an extension of principal component analysis (Chapter @ref (principal-component-analysis)) suited to explore relationships among qualitative variables (or categorical data). Like principal component analysis, it provides a solution for summarizing and visualizing data set in two-dimension plots.
